What is the best height for a clothesline?

The average height of a clothesline is around 6 ft to 7 1/2 ft tall. It is best to make your line tall enough so the laundry doesn't touch the ground but low enough to accommodate the height of the person hanging out the laundry.

What height should a clothesline be mounted?

Recommended height position from ground level to wall bracket top mounting hole is user height + 100mm minimum. If required, allow 80mm minimum clearance on each side of wall bracket to clear side walls or fences when folding clothesline up or down.

What size post for clothesline?

The clothesline will exert significant pressure on the clothesline post, especially when there are wet clothes hanging from the line, the post must be very solid and firmly planted in the ground. Treated wood: Use a 6" × 6" post available in length of 16'.

What is the minimum height for a laundry drain?

Siphoning. The drain pipe should be a minimum of 1-1/2" I.D. (inside diameter) to ensure proper draining. The Washer drain hose is a 1-1/4" O.D. (outside diameter). To be confident that no siphoning of water will take place, the drain plumbing must be a minimum of 30" high for Top Load Washers.

How should washing be hung on the line?

The laundry should be spread out or hung staggered so that the air can circulate better. The greater the distance, the better the circulation and the faster the laundry dries. Laundry should always be secured outdoors to prevent it from falling.

What is the average length of a clothes line?

The length of the line depends on the size of your back yard, but 20 to 25 feet is average. You'll need two strong supports, such as trees or a post of your porch. Choose an area of the yard where the clothesline won't get in anyone's way.

How far apart should clothesline posts be?

Distance between posts should be no more than 30 feet. 2. Mark the lower post 12 inches from the bottom. Be certain that this line remains at ground level during the entire installation.

What is code for drain height?

Discharge/drain hole (vertical): 16-20 inches from floor. Fixture (side to side buffer): 15 inches minimum from centerline, 20 inches recommended. Fixture (front buffer): 21 inches minimum to nearest obstruction, 30 inches recommended.

What is the minimum height for a standpipe?

Standpipes shall extend not less than 18 inches (457 mm) and not greater than 42 inches (1067 mm) above the trap weir. ❖ A standpipe is typically used for capturing the waste flow from a pumped discharge plumbing appliance such as a dishwasher or a clothes washer.

How high to install a laundry box?

Remember to install above the water height of the washer. This is typically 42 in. from the floor to the top of the outlet box. If you're replacing an existing outlet box, shut off the water supply and drain the water lines.

What would be the safest way to hang a clothes line?

For a more permanent and versatile clothesline, the rope or cord should be tied between two sturdy anchor points such as two poles. You can also attach one end to your house, garage, shed or even a tree. Whatever you choose, be ready to drill holes so that you can attach screw hooks to your two anchor points.

What is the average clothes line size?

A standard rotary clothesline suitable for large households typically measures between 3.5 to 5 metres in diameter, providing ample hanging space without taking up too much room. Fold down clotheslines usually require a wall space of about 2.4 to 3.6 metres to install effectively, making them ideal for larger spaces.

What is the best direction for a clothesline?

Give consideration to selecting a level, north or south facing site to achieve the maximum amount of sunlight, and away from view if possible.

What is the best wood for clothesline?

As for hardwood, it is best to opt for the 'heartwood' of cypress, cedar, teak, or redwood. The heartwood is the dense, innermost part of the tree trunk and serves as the main supporting structure, and out of the species we have mentioned above, teak and redwood are some of the best.
